安装最新版nginx-1.25.1.tar.gz包
[root@suian src]# wget https://nginx.org/download/nginx-1.25.1.tar.gz
上次发布的文章是使用编译方式安装的nginx-1.24.0版本,本章节记录了平滑升级到nginx-1.25.1版本。
在生产环境中尽量使用平滑升级,操作没问题不需要关闭服务,从而达到免停升级服务。
[root@suian src]# ls
nginx-1.24.0 nginx-1.25.1 nginx-1.25.1.tar.gz
[root@suian src]# cd nginx-1.25.1/
#目前版本还是1.24.0
[root@suian nginx-1.25.1]# /apps/nginx/sbin/nginx -v
nginx version: nginx/1.24.0
[root@suian nginx-1.25.1]# /apps/nginx/sbin/nginx -V
nginx version: nginx/1.24.0
built by gcc 8.5.0 20210514 (Red Hat 8.5.0-18) (GCC)
built with OpenSSL 1.1.1k FIPS 25 Mar 2021
TLS SNI support enabled
configure arguments: --prefix=/apps/nginx --user=nginx --group=nginx --with-http_ssl_module --with-http_v2_module --with-http_realip_module --with-http_stub_status_module --with-http_gzip_static_module --with-pcre --with-stream --with-stream_ssl_module --with-stream_realip_module